Day 1:
Upon your arrival in Budapest, you will be met by Golf Travel Hungary’s representative.

Day 2:
First you will play at the Tata Old Lake Golf & Country Club, 45 minutes from Budapest, which hosted the first professional women's golf tournament in the East-Central-European region, the OTP Bank Ladies Central European Open in 2004/2005/2006.
After golfing you will visit the Hilltop Winery in Neszmély.  A walking tour of the vineyard, wine tasting, and dinner at the local restaurant end the day’s program.

Day 3:
Today, you will be playing at the Pólus Palace Golf & Country Club in Göd which hosted the Hungarian Open Golf Championship in 2007, and is just 20 minutes from the downtown.
After golf you can enjoy Pólus Palace’s wellness center with a 10-function adventure-pool with thermal water, a steam bath, a Finnish sauna, an infra sauna, and dipping pool.

Day 4: free
Our program includes a dinner at Bock Bistro, at the intimate wine restaurant on the Grand Boulevard, next to the Grand Hotel Royal.
Bock offers red wines from Villány, Hungary’s best red wine region.

Day 5:
This morning, after breakfast, you will play at the Pannonia Golf & Country Club, which is 40 minutes from Budapest and the highest quality golf course in Hungary.  It is a must play course as Pannonia Golf & Country Club won the B.I.D. International Quality award in Gold Category for Customer Satisfaction, Quality, and Business Excellence in 2004.
After playing you will visit Etyek, a small village near the golf course. The Haraszthy Vallejo Winery offers traditional Hungarian white wines with snacks.
